Brief Instructions
To query the compatibility information you require, you must first choose a "master component" (WinCC, PCS 7, STEP 7, ...). To these "master components" you can add more components (such as operating systems, virus scanners, ...). Once you have chosen the components you require, you can have the compatibility list shown by hitting the "Show compatibility" button. STEP 7
As from version STEP 7 V5.5 SP1, STEP 7 is enabled for a 64-bit operating system in the Windows 7 and Windows Server 2008 R2 operating systems.
You need the full version of STEP 7 V5.5 SP1 or higher for the installation. A service pack or an update/hotfix is only for upgrading an existing installation.

Tips and tricks to check STEP 7- compatibilityGo to beginning
Part number:

Configuration Notes:
This entry includes tips and tricks on STEP 7 compatibility.

  1. Can a STEP 7 project from a current version be edited in a previous version?
  2. Can the communication cards CP5511 and CP5512 be used with STEP 7 V5.4 in MS Windows Vista?
  3. Which version of STEP 7 fully supports the scroll wheel functions of the Microsoft wheel mice?
  4. Why are the symbolic names not available if a program created with STEP 7 V5.4 is downloaded from the CPU into the PG with STEP 7 V5.3?

The table below provides information and remedies for the above.
 
No. Procedure:
1 Can a STEP 7 project from a current version be edited in a previous version?
STEP 7 projects are downwards compatible to the previous versions. Projects created in version 5.4 can also be edited in version 5.3. A prerequisite is that the project created in STEP 7 V5.4 cannot contain any components and functions not supported by the previous version, such as new CPU modules or new functions (such as access protection or SIMATIC Version Trail).
  • If a STEP 7 V5.4 project is to be processed, for example with STEP 7 V5.3, then you can only use module order numbers that are known in version V5.3 in the V5.4 project. If necessary, you should configure new modules with the "predecessor order number".
  • In future you will be able to "retroload" new modules as of STEP 7 V5.2 .

Refer also to the note in the readme file in section 6.6 "Changing between the different versions of STEP 7", "New modules in old versions of STEP 7". If you open or dearchive a project in STEP 7 version V5.2 that has been created in version V5.3 or V5.4, the following messages might be displayed. As a consequence, you can only read the hardware configuration.

  • S7 Hardware Update options package not available.
  • The project includes objects of the "Hardware Update" options package that cannot be processed because the options package is not installed or an obsolete version of it is installed.
2 Can the communication cards CP5511 and CP5512 be used with STEP 7 V5.4 in MS Windows Vista?
STEP 7 is released in Windows Vista Ultimate and Business as of version V5.4 SP3. STEP 7 is not released in Windows Vista Home Basic or Premium. To use the communication cards, note that the
  • CP5512 is released in Windows Vista, the driver is integrated in STEP 7,
  • CP5511 is not released in Windows Vista.

More information is available in the readme file under "Notes on using communication cards in PCs/PGs (section 4.4.2).

3 Which version of STEP 7 fully supports the scroll wheel functions of the Microsoft wheel mice?
As of version 5.2, STEP 7 supports the scroll wheel function of the Microsoft wheel mice. However, you must install the driver for your mouse separately (the Windows default driver is not sufficient here). The driver is supplied by your mouse manufacturer, usually on a separate CD.

Once you have installed the mouse driver, restart the computer and a mouse icon is displayed in the task bar (next to the clock). Open the Control Panel via "Start > Settings > Control Panel" and double-click on the "Mouse" icon. You can make additional mouse settings in the dialog window "Mouse Properties".


Fig. 01

4 Why are the symbolic names not available if a program created with STEP 7 V5.4 is downloaded from the CPU into the PG with STEP 7 V5.3?
Please refer to the information in the STEP 7 Online Help under
  • "Downloading from the PLC into the PG",
  • "Load station into PG..."

The blocks are stored in the CPU irrespective of the STEP 7 version without symbols and comments. To keep the assignment of the symbols and comments for your program, load the program back into the associated project.

How do you check a STEP 7 project for the software packages required to edit the STEP 7 project?Go to beginning
Part number:

Instructions:
If you edit a project that contains objects which have been created with software package, then you need that software package for editing the project. When you open a project it is automatically checked for the software packages required. Then the software packages missing on your system are displayed.

First you get the message indicating that one or more objects of a type cannot be displayed and that the server S7 ... could not be loaded. Acknowledge this message with OK. You are then presented with a list of the names of the missing software packages (e.g. S7-HiGraph - Fig. 01).


Fig. 01

Mark the project name in the SIMATIC Manager and select the Project Properties dialog via Edit > Object Properties. In the dialog that opens you select the Required software packages tab. This displays a list of all the software packages used for this STEP 7 project and whether or not they are installed on your PC.


Fig. 02

For example, if you wish to forward projects you have created yourself to other persons (e.g. colleagues / business partners), then for project editing it is useful to know which software packages are required. In this way you can adapt your project to your colleagues' STEP 7 installation, which might not be as extended as yours.

For this you select the project in the SIMATIC Manager and then the menu command Edit > Object Properties > Tab: Required software packages". Here you will find an overview of the software packages required for editing this project.


Fig. 03

The information on the software packages required is complete if:

  • the project (or all the projects in a multiproject) or the library have been created with STEP 7 V5.2 or higher
  • the project has been checked for software packages used - the check is made automatically when you open or dearchive an S7 project.

 

Why does a message appear indicating that a foreign language has to be installed in the operating system when a project is opened from STEP 7 version V5.3 SP2?Go to beginning
Part number:

 

Description:
From STEP 7 version V5.3 SP2, the system outputs a message indicating that the project can only be opened in the Windows language specified;

  • in projects which have been newly created from STEP 7 V5.3 SP2 and
  • which have been created in an operating system language which does not correspond to one of the STEP 7 languages or
  • the current Windows language, and
  • if the project has not been set to be language-neutral.

Please follow the instructions in the Readme file (section 2.26 Information about using foreign-language character sets). From STEP 7 V5.3 SP2 you can use foreign language character sets other than the STEP 7 language set. However, the setting for this requested character set must be defined in the operating system.

If you wish to open your STEP 7 project or your library under any language setting, you have to activate the option

  • "Can be opened in any language in the Windows Regional and Language Option (l. neutral)"

in the project's object properties. Follow the procedure described in the table below.  
No. Procedure
1 Set the operating system to the language which has been used to create the project. To switch the operating system to another language, you must change the settings for the menus and dialogs in the Control Panel. You can find information about this setting procedure in our FAQ
  • "How to switch the operating system to English"
    , which you can find on the Internet in Entry ID 22309945 .
2 Then, in order to back up your STEP 7 project, make a copy of your project via "File > Save as...".
3 Highlight the name of the project in the SIMATIC Manager and right-click it. Then select "Object properties" in the pop-up menu that opens.


Fig. 01

4 Go to the "General" tab in the "Properties - Project" dialog and enable the following option:
  • "Can be opened in any language in the Windows Regional and Language Option (l. neutral)"

and click OK to confirm the message which appears then.


Fig. 02

After saving with OK, you can use the project or library in different language-speaking areas with different character sets. Multiple projects are always created on a language-neutral basis.

Note:
A project should only be set to be language-neutral if the programmer is sure that no language-specific characters have been used in this project (which would lead to nonsensical characters in another operating system language).

These instructions have been verified with STEP 7 V5.3.

Which foreign language character sets and special characters can be used in STEP 7?Go to beginning
Part number:

Configuration Notes:
The following table contains some information on the foreign language character sets and special characters in STEP 7:
 
No. Foreign language character sets and special characters in STEP 7:
1 Foreign language character sets:
From STEP 7 V5.3 SP2 you can use foreign language character sets in projects and libraries other than the STEP 7 language set. Requirements:
  • You must have Windows Multilingual User Interface (e.g. MS Windows XP MUI) installed on your PC and
  • The setting for this requested character set must be defined in the operating system.

More information is available in the STEP 7 Online Help under "Note on Using Foreign-Language Character Sets" and under "Settings the Windows Language." The following foreign language character sets are released under MS Windows MUI:

  • Japanese
  • Chinese (Simplified)
  • Korean
  • Russian
  • Greek

Also note the "Note on Using Foreign-Language Character Sets" (section 6) in the STEP 7 readme file.

2 Special characters in STEP 7:
From STEP 7 V5.2 you can enter special characters for documentation purposes or as a comment without any restrictions.

If you are using a version of STEP 7 < V5.2, then it might not be possible to enter special characters directly in every STEP 7 application. For example, in STEP 7 V5.1 it is possible to enter special characters directly in comment fields in the HW Config, but not in block or network comment fields in the LAD/FBD/STL editor.
In this case you can enter the special characters via the relevant ASCII codes. To enter characters via their ASCII codes you must press and hold the ALT key and enter the relevant code via the numbers keypad.

Please note that you cannot use special characters in every input field. For example, special characters are not usually permitted in tag names.
